
Easy Chicken Tikka Masala
Restaurant-quality chicken tikka masala made at home in 40 minutes. Creamy tomato sauce, tender charred chicken, and bloomed aromatic spices.

Instructions
- 1Marinate chicken in yogurt, lemon juice, garam masala, cumin, turmeric, paprika, and salt for at least 15 minutes (overnight if possible).
- 2Char the chicken in a hot skillet with oil for 3-4 minutes per side until caramelized. It doesn't need to be fully cooked yet. Set aside.
- 3In the same pan, melt butter over medium heat. Add onion, cook 8 minutes until deeply golden.
- 4Add garlic and ginger. Cook 1 minute. Add dry spices (garam masala, cumin, coriander, turmeric). Bloom for 60 seconds — this is the flavor foundation.
- 5Add crushed tomatoes. Simmer 10 minutes until thickened.
- 6Add cream and charred chicken. Simmer 10 more minutes until chicken is cooked through and sauce is rich. Serve over basmati rice with fresh cilantro.
